<p>There will be incoming Natural Sciences freshmen who have registered for early June orientations that will cancel. Their slots will be backfilled via on-line registration on the day that they cancel. </p>

<p>The people New Student Services @ 471-3304 can tell you the date that they expect the greatest # of cancellations - usually the last date registrants can cancel and get a refund on their deposit.</p>

<p>Also check the registration sign-up website frequently. When a registrant cancels, their spot will be made available as soon as the Orientation office processes it. It’s strictly a matter of being on-line when an opening is made available. </p>

<p>If you don’t get in via on-line registration, there will be registrants who just don’t show up. If you want to take your chances, you can go to the Orientation sign-in table and get on a waitlist to backfill slots of no-shows.</p>
